Just This One Thing

Let us dispense with philosophical posturing;
with endless theorizing, and round about reasoning.
Let us speak always and only of Messiah and his love.
Let's praise His name and be thankful
that He came from above.

Speak not to me of the so called great men of this earth.
I don't care to be impressed by what you think they are worth.
Speak only to my soul, about the sweet Rose of Sharon.
Let His name be lifted up, he is the sinner's champion.

Seek not to use your talents for earthy and foolish pleasure;
remember, wherever your heart is there also is your treasure.
Besides, only what's done in his name, will last forever.
Don't be fooled or blinded by the devil, this is not a game.

Seek not to embroil my mind in endless debate,
while souls are being lost and the hour's getting late.
Teach me instead, to seek out the lost like Messiah did.
He spared no cost or effort for the souls of men to bid.

Don't seek to pacify my soul with songs that shout His name;
if you know, deep inside, all you're seeking is vain fame.
Lift up the name of Messiah with sincerity and gladness.
For to trifle with His name is tantamount to madness.

Do not use the time of prayer to impress
the ears of those who hear.
You bow before the awful presence of Him,
by whose name the angels swear.
Instead, lift up the name of Messiah with humble spirit.
Before Him you're a sinner saved by grace, and not by merit.

Do nothing in His name to further personal agenda.
Do you have a dream? Or a vision?
Then to his will surrender.

Oh!

Come let us worship Him in the beauty  of holiness.
Let us praise His name with pure hearts,
and worship him in singleness.
Offer in his presence a broke and contrite spirit,
and he guarantees by his word that you'll
receive forgiveness.
